CVE-2025-8876 added to CISA KEV: N-able N-Central
Status: ✅ Confirmed exploited in the wild
Date added: 2025-08-13
Required action: Apply mitigations per vendor instructions, follow applicable BOD 22-01 guidance for cloud services, or discontinue use of the product if mitigations are unavailable.
Due date: 2025-08-20
Why this matters
N-able N-Central contains a command injection vulnerability via improper sanitization of user input.
